Daniel Wu just served up the ultimate throwback on his Instagram page. Popping up a photo of himself squeezed next to three of Hong Kong cinema’s biggest stars, I’m sure you won’t have any trouble identifying everyone. But if you need any hints, the caption hilariously says it all.

Here’s another oldie but goodie someone just sent me. Not sure when this was taken maybe 10-15 years ago judging by how much hair I had? Jackie Chan, Andy Lau and Tony Leung absolute legends! #backintheday”. Absolute legends indeed! I certainly have fond childhood memories watching classic “cops and robbers” flicks from all four. From Jackie Chan and Daniel’s New Police Story collaboration to Andy La uand Tony Leung’s Infernal Affairs which by far is still one my favourites, there’s no escaping these superstars if you’re talking about Hong Kong classics!

Unfortunately, it’s been a long while since we’ve seen any collaborations between them. But the good news is that Andy and Tony have already completed filming their upcoming project East Side Stories aka Once Upon a Time in Hong Kong last year. Here’s hoping we’ll see everyone working with each other once again soon!

Meanwhile, look out for Daniel in Disney+’s upcoming series American Born Chinese where he plays Chinese mythology’s legendary Monkey King – Sun Wukong. American Born Chinese is an action fantasy series about a teenager who accidentally finds himself entangled in a battle between the gods of Chinese mythology all whilst trying to balance fitting into his American high school with his immigrant home life.
